77-3-211: Limitation on public inspection rights.

The department shall withhold from public inspection any information obtained from a lessee under this part if the information relates to proprietary geological information. The withholding is effective for as long as the department considers necessary, but in no event may be less than 5 years after the expiration of the lease or permit, to protect the lessee's economic interest in the proprietary geologic information against unwarranted injury or to protect the public's best interest.
